Easy Samoa Brownies: An Incredible Ultimate Recipe

Ingredients

For the Brownies:
– 1 cup unsalted butter, melted
– 2 cups granulated sugar
– 4 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 cup all-purpose flour
– 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
– ½ teaspoon salt
– ½ teaspoon baking powder

For the Topping:
– 2 cups sweetened shredded coconut
– 1 cup caramel sauce
– ½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
– 2 tablespoons coconut oil (for melting)


Instructions

Creating Easy Samoa Brownies is a straightforward process, ensuring your baking experience is as enjoyable as indulging in the final product. Follow these steps for guaranteed success:

1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and line a 9×13-inch baking pan with parchment paper.
2. Mix the Brownie Batter: In a large bowl, combine melted butter and granulated sugar. Mix until well combined.
3.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Add the eggs, one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in vanilla extract.
4. Combine Dry Ingredients: In another bowl, sift together the flour, cocoa powder, salt, and baking powder.
5.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until smooth and no lumps remain.
6. Pour the Brownie Batter: Spread the brownie mixture evenly into the prepared baking pan.
7. Bake Brownies: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
8. Toast the Coconut: While brownies are baking, spread the shredded coconut on a baking sheet and toast in the oven for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ally until golden brown. Remove and set aside.
9. Prepare the Topping: In a medium saucepan, heat the caramel sauce gently, stirring until it’s smooth.
10. Assemble the Layers: Once the brownies are baked, remove from the oven and let them cool slightly. Pour the warm caramel sauce over the brownies, then evenly sprinkle the toasted coconut on top.
11. Melt Chocolate: In a microwave-safe bowl, combine chocolate chips and coconut oil. Micro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ring until fully melted and smooth.
12. Drizzle Chocolate: Drizzle the melted chocolate over the caramel and coconut layer, creating a beautiful finish.
13. Cool Completely: All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an on a wire rack. This will let the toppings set properly.
14. Cut and Serve: Once cool, remove from the pan using the parchment paper and cut into square pieces.

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25-30 minutes
